async def handle_login(request):
    state = str(uuid.uuid4())
    callback_path = request.app.router["oauth2-callback"].url_for()
    if not request.app.openid_config:
        raise web.HTTPNotFound(text='login is disabled on this instance')
    location = URL(
        request.app.openid_config["authorization_endpoint"]).with_query({
            "client_id":
            request.app.config.oauth2_provider.client_id
            or os.environ['OAUTH2_CLIENT_ID'],
            "redirect_uri":
            str(request.app.external_url.join(callback_path)),
            "response_type":
            "code",
            "scope":
            "openid",
            "state":
            state,
        })
    response = web.HTTPFound(location)
    response.set_cookie("state",
                        state,
                        max_age=60,
                        path=callback_path,
                        httponly=True,
                        secure=True)
    if "url" in request.query:
        try:
            response.set_cookie("back_url",
                                str(URL(request.query["url"]).relative()))
        except ValueError:
            # 'url' is not a URL
            raise web.HTTPBadRequest(text='invalid url')
    return response

async def handle_oauth_callback(request):
    code = request.query.get("code")
    state_code = request.query.get("state")
    if request.cookies.get("state") != state_code:
        return web.Response(status=400, text="state variable mismatch")
    if not request.app.openid_config:
        raise web.HTTPNotFound(text='login disabled')
    token_url = URL(request.app.openid_config["token_endpoint"])
    redirect_uri = (request.app.external_url or request.url).join(
        request.app.router["oauth2-callback"].url_for())
    params = {
        "code":
        code,
        "client_id":
        request.app.config.oauth2_provider.client_id
        or os.environ['OAUTH2_CLIENT_ID'],
        "client_secret":
        request.app.config.oauth2_provider.client_secret
        or os.environ['OAUTH2_CLIENT_SECRET'],
        "grant_type":
        "authorization_code",
        "redirect_uri":
        str(redirect_uri),
    }
    async with request.app.http_client_session.post(token_url,
                                                    params=params) as resp:
        if resp.status != 200:
            return web.json_response(status=resp.status,
                                     data={"error": "token-error"})
        resp = await resp.json()
        if resp["token_type"] != "Bearer":
            return web.Response(
                status=500,
                text="Expected bearer token, got %s" % resp["token_type"],
            )
        refresh_token = resp["refresh_token"]  # noqa: F841
        access_token = resp["access_token"]

    try:
        back_url = request.cookies["back_url"]
    except KeyError:
        back_url = "/"

    async with request.app.http_client_session.get(
            request.app.openid_config["userinfo_endpoint"],
            headers={"Authorization": "Bearer %s" % access_token},
    ) as resp:
        if resp.status != 200:
            raise Exception("unable to get user info (%s): %s" %
                            (resp.status, await resp.read()))
        userinfo = await resp.json()
    session_id = str(uuid.uuid4())
    async with request.app.database.acquire() as conn:
        await conn.execute(
            """
INSERT INTO site_session (id, userinfo) VALUES ($1, $2)
ON CONFLICT (id) DO UPDATE SET userinfo = EXCLUDED.userinfo
""", session_id, userinfo)

    # TODO(jelmer): Store access token / refresh token?

    resp = web.HTTPFound(back_url)

    resp.del_cookie("state")
    resp.del_cookie("back_url")
    resp.set_cookie("session_id", session_id, secure=True, httponly=True)
    return resp
